55.4% of the people in Northport (zip 35473) are religious:
- 33.4% are Baptist
- 1.0% are Episcopalian
- 2.0% are Catholic
- 0.1% are Lutheran
- 7.1% are Methodist
- 1.8% are Pentecostal
- 1.5% are Presbyterian
- 0.7% are Church of Jesus Christ
- 7.6% are another Christian faith
- 0.1% are Judaism
- 0.0% are an eastern faith
- 0.2% affilitates with Islam
